Hi Larry,

Can you give us a status update for your PEP 649? I don't recall reading anything about it in the past few weeks. I am super excited about this solution to the problem (even if there are a few issues to work through) and I think it will provide better backwards compatibility than the current plan for Python 3.10 (PEP 563, from __future__ import annotations, causing all annotations to be stringified).

If we don't get this into 3.10, we'd have a much more complicated transition. There are only two more alphas before 3.10b1 gets released! And we'd have to get this approved by the Steering Council, which can take a few weeks (cut them some slack, they have a big backlog). Fortunately you already have an implementation that can be landed quickly once the PEP is accepted.
